Crude oil remained steady near $68 a barrel with tanker traffic through the Strait of Hormuz recovering after an interim U.S.-Iran peace deal. Saudi exports reached about 90 percent of pre-war levels while UBS cut its Brent forecasts.
bloombergquint.com-Iran peace deal. @FirstSquawk reported that Saudi crude exports recovered to about 90 percent of pre-war levels, adding to global supply. Bloomberg data showed Saudi Arabia shipped 6.3 million barrels a day in the six days through Wednesday.
-Iran negotiations are continuing and that Iran has agreed to just about everything the United States needs. Reuters reported that Iranian crude exports regained momentum as the U.S. blockade eased and Hormuz transits recovered to about 50 percent of pre-conflict levels.
Brent's prompt spread briefly flipped into contango. Citigroup said oil market fundamentals are reasserting themselves as Hormuz disruptions fade and shipping flows normalize. UBS lowered its 2026 Brent average price forecast to $83.74 per barrel from $93.28 and its 2027 forecast to $75 per barrel.
